ZINN WILL HELP YOU FIX YOUR BIKE!

You're holding the world's best-selling do-it-yourself guide to how to repair your bicycle. Lennard Zinn's easy-to-follow instructions will help you make quick work of any maintenance and repair job on any road or cyclocross bike. Learn how to take care of every part of your bicycle: basic tune-ups; derailleur adjustment to fix shifting problems; how to true a wheel, fix a flat, adjust brakes, maintain or replace a chain, troubleshoot noises, service a bottom bracket-it's all here, with hundreds of detailed illustrations of how parts go together and time-saving tips for doing the job right. Itemized lists explain which tools you'll need, whether you are stocking a workshop or tackling a roadside repair.

No matter what type of road bike you own, old or new, Lennard Zinn's clear instructions will help you maintain it, fix it, upgrade it, and keep it running smoothly for years to come. Everything you need to know about your bike is in this book!

Bicycle Basics

  • How to do your own bike fit
  • Simple instructions for regular bicycle care

Complete Bike Repair

  • How to fix every bike part: brakes, wheels, tires, headsets, pedals, derailleurs, chains, hubs, handlebars, seatposts, saddles, shifters

Solve Common Bicycle Problems

  • Diagnose and fix problems like a skipping chain, rough shiften, squeaky brakes, loose spokes, or a stuck seatpost

The Ultimate Reference

  • Exhaustive troubleshooting index, glossary of terms, torque specifications, gear chart for compact and regular cranks

Lennard Zinn is the world's leading expert on bike maintenance and repair. He was a member of the U.S. national racing team and has been riding and fixing bikes for nearly 50 years. A professional frame builder and bike designer, Lennard is also a technical writer for VeloNews magazine and hosts the popular Tech Q&A on VeloNews.com.
